Saif Ali Khan withdraws his controversial statement on Adipurush

Published on Monday, 07 Dec 2020 06:59 AM

Bollywood star Saif Ali Khan’s statements on Prabhas’ Adipurush in a recent interview have led to a controversy. Saif, who’s going to play the demon king Lankesh in Adipurush, said that the film’s director Om Raut has humanized Ravan’s character and justified him abducting Sita and his war with lord Rama.

Many Hindu groups, political leaders and Hindus have strongly condemned Saif’s comments. Noticing the unexpected backlash, Saif has now withdrawn his controversial statement. In a press note, Saif said that hurting people’s sentiments was never his intention.

“I would like to sincerely apologise to everybody and withdraw my statement. Lord Ram has always been the symbol of Righteousness and Heroism for me. Adipurush is about celebrating the victory of good over evil and the entire team is working together to present the epic without any distortions,” Saif said, putting an end to the controversy.
